Stopped in to grab dinner for my daughter and myself. My BF raves about this restaurant (other locations) so I trusted her. The wait wasn't bad. There was plenty of social distancing space. Clean floors and counters. My daughter ordered the shrimp and I got the catfish. Surprisingly, my 7-year old LOVED her food. Me, not so much. I asked for Cajun seasoning-easy salt. What I got was bland. AND the insult was the catfish dinner came with one (1) lonely fillet with a bunch of potatoes and very little broccoli. Like....Chris Rock ASKED for 1 RIB!! I could have purchased an entire bag of potatoes, broccoli and pack of catfish for 1/2 of what I paid. So what's the hype about these places? Because the food is perfectly steamed and all in a pan? No thank you. I know how to cook. And I know how to save my money.
